Common use of Cessation of Accrual Clause in Contracts

Cessation of Accrual. An employee who is granted a leave of absence without pay and who is off the payroll for less than one hundred-sixty consecutive hours shall receive his or her earned sick leave credit. If the employee is off the payroll for one hundred-sixty (160) consecutive hours or more, he or she shall not earn sick leave credit for each two successive pay periods that he or she is off the payroll.
